Approval of Cornwall Housing and Celtic Sea Power Four‑Year Business Plans and related BEIS funding
The council approved the four‑year business plans for Cornwall Housing and Celtic Sea Power and will release £0.371 million from BEIS funds and up to £1.827 million over four years to support Celtic Sea Power Ltd.
Cabinet·2026-03-18
Description
The Council approved the Cornwall Housing Four‑Year Business Plan (2026‑30) and the Celtic Sea Power Four‑Year Business Plan, and authorised the release of £0.371 million from BEIS dowry funds and up to £1.827 million over four years to fund Celtic Sea Power Ltd.
